Following the Intense Euro Qualifying Match, Croatian Media Faces Challenges and Criticism

Posted on November 22, 2023

The Croats emerged victorious in their match against Armenia with a score of 1-0, but the best chance to score lay with Armenia, according to colleagues from the portal Blic.rs. Following Croatia’s win, headlines on various portals read: “The end of the European qualifiers went well for Serbia: the Croats they got through and are going to the EURO,” “Croatia at the European Championship: ‘Vatreni’ won a visa to Germany with great difficulty,” and “The best individual on the field was Ognjen Čančarević.” However, some portals expressed clumsiness in their headlines, such as B92 which wrote: “Serb on Maksimir tormented Croatia, but the ‘fiery’ are going to the Euros.”

On Bosnia and Herzegovina’s sportsport.ba portal, colleagues were in a better mood and wrote: “The best when it’s the hardest – Croatia checked their ticket for the Euros in a packed Maksimir.” Despite differences in opinions on other portals, it is clear that Croatia has earned their spot in the big competition in Germany.
